2003 Boxster S - 24,850 miles, excellent condition

For your consideration and review, my 2003 Boxster S. My story: researched what I wanted for over six months. Looked for it for another six months. Found it. Bought it. Brought it up to my standards. Drove it and enjoyed it. Wife hates the two seater. Won't go anywhere in it with me. I'm selling it for a four door. That simple. Not in a huge rush to sell. I know this car is near the top of the 986 line, in both mileage and features.

PRICE: $19,000
LOCATION: Seattle WA area

-24,850 miles and slowly climbing on weekends to keep things lubed and happy.
-Black, Black, Black

Service
-Pre purchase inspection by Sunset Porsche in Portland OR showed no significant deficiencies. All items identified were addressed after purchase. Additional post purchase inspection by local independent Porsche shop validated the first inspection.
-I had All fluids flushed by Porsche dealer at 20k, replaced with factory fluids
-Oil changed with synthetic by local independent Porsche shop around 20k have to verify mileage
-Replaced any little plastic bits and bobs that were missing or looked faded or worn in the last year
-New ignition switch due to the typical failure of cheap plastic part
-Replaced air filter and cabin filter, gas cap, radiator fill tank cap
-Have new drive belt, haven't put on because old one looks fine

Features
-Porsche CD player with BOSE speaker system including rear subwoofer
-6 Speed Manual
-Litronic projector headlights
-I'm told my wheels are Carrera lightweight wheels but don't know for sure, judge by photos
-Glass window convertible top with rear defrost
-Newer tires (<10k miles)
-Red 'S' on rear badge, increases hp +15, unlocks top speed. No really, I think it looks great on the black cars and I'd do it again in a heartbeat.

Answers to your inevitable questions:
-No IMS work done. The car is fine as is. If you're a big IMS person, factor that into your budget but my price stands aside from this.

-The CARFAX is clean, no accidents. Front bumper was resprayed by previous owner due to undesired rock chips. I think it looks perfect, you be the judge.

-Why did I price it where I did?
-A: Higher than all the high mileage 03/04 S models in the $15-17k range but lower than the Anniversary editions in the $22-25k range. Lets be honest here folks its a 14 year old Porsche with only 25k miles. If this is the car you're looking for, lets not quibble over $3k.
